GBTG Hedge Fund Activity: Q3 2025 in Review

163 of the 7,620 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in American Express Global Business Travel (GBTG) for Q3 2025, worth a combined $2.22B — up 45% from $1.54B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 31 funds opened new GBTG positions and 27 closed out — a net gain of 4 holders — while 53 added to existing stakes and 55 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Redwood Capital Management, opening a new position worth an estimated $159M. The largest seller was Carronade Capital Management, cutting an estimated $6.72M.
